Output e52070a63e2847d63aeff805fc4852b28ea31e4edbfc42d39b4c579e1b84d4ea:8

value
4192656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87ffbf6abe3052c48a8f488d95405cd409a07290 OP_EQUAL
address
3E67X6zbRbaawAVGeCAE4AozabLF9h3qMc
transaction
e52070a63e2847d63aeff805fc4852b28ea31e4edbfc42d39b4c579e1b84d4ea
spent
true